Overview

Semler turned his family's business, the aging Semco corporation of Brazil, into the most revolutionary business success story of our time. By eliminating uneeded layers of management and allowing employees unprecedented democracy in the workplace, he created a company that challenged the old ways and blazed a path to success in an uncertain economy.

  • Anonymous

    Posted December 31, 2003

    Amazing things can happen when you believe in others.

    Easily the best business book I've ever read. Semler really connected with me due to his passion for doing things the right way - utmost sincerity. Many books leave the impression that it was written by managers for managers, letting them in on secrets of how to manipulate your people for fun and profit. Not so here. Sure, employee empowerment is not new. What is new here is that whole story of how Semler's 'Entrepreneurial Democracy' came to be. It's not a book by academics focusing on the psychology of teamwork and motivation - it's a book by someone who actually made the change with their own company. You're there with him to see the experiences, problems, and turning points that got them where they are today. For those who are more interested in seeing how these ideas were developed over time instead of simply being told what's the right way to do something - this is your business book.
